Product Introduction

Overview

The ADT7301ARTZ-500RL7 is a highly accurate and efficient digital temperature sensor produced by Analog Devices Inc. This component is part of the ADT7301 series and is designed to provide precise temperature measurements over a wide range. It features a band gap temperature sensor and a 13-bit analog-to-digital converter (ADC), enabling it to monitor and digitize temperature readings with high accuracy.

The device is available in a compact 6-lead SOT-23 package, making it suitable for a variety of applications where space is limited. It operates within a temperature range of -40°C to +150°C, making it versatile for use in diverse environmental conditions.

Key Features

  • High Accuracy: The ADT7301ARTZ-500RL7 offers high temperature measurement accuracy of ±0.5°C typical at 0°C to 70°C.
  • Low Power Consumption: The device features low power dissipation, with a typical power consumption of 631mW at VDD = 3.3V and a shutdown current of 1μA maximum.
  • Wide Operating Range: It operates over a wide temperature range of -40°C to +150°C, making it suitable for various applications.
  • Compact Package: Available in a 6-lead SOT-23 package, which is ideal for space-constrained designs.
  • Digital Interface: Uses a 4-wire SPI interface for easy communication with microcontrollers and other digital systems.
  • Automatic Conversion Sequence: Features an internal clock oscillator that initiates automatic temperature conversions every 1.5 seconds, reducing the need for external clocking.
  • Shutdown Mode: Includes a power-down bit that allows the device to enter a low-power shutdown mode, further reducing power consumption.
